Zabbix on avoimen lähdekoodin valvontatyökalu, jossa voit valvoa palvelimia, virtuaalikoneita, verkkoja, pilvipalveluja ja paljon muuta. Se on erittäin hyödyllinen työkalu pienille, keskisuurille ja suurille IT -organisaatioille.
Voit asentaa Zabbixin Raspberry Pi -laitteeseen ja seurata sen avulla kotiverkon muiden tietokoneiden/palvelimien verkkoa.
Tässä artikkelissa aion näyttää sinulle, kuinka voit määrittää Zabbixin Raspberry Pi -laitteeseesi seurataksesi kotiverkon muiden tietokoneiden/palvelimien verkkoa.
Asioita, joita tarvitset
Tämän artikkelin noudattamiseksi tarvitset Raspberry Pi -piirilevyn, johon on asennettu Zabbix 5.
Jos tarvitset apua Zabbix 5: n asentamisessa Raspberry Pi -levytietokoneeseesi, lue artikkelini aiheesta Zabbix 5: n asentaminen Raspberry Pi 4: een .
Olen asentanut Zabbix 5: n Raspberry Pi -laitteeseeni (käynnissä Raspberry Pi OS). Raspberry Pi -laitteen IP -osoite on 192.168.0.106 . Joten aion käyttää Zabbix 5 -verkkosovellusta URL -osoitteen avulla http://192.168.0.106/zabbix . Raspberry Pi -laitteen IP -osoite on erilainen. Muista siis korvata se omallasi tästä lähtien.
Mikä on Zabbix Agent?
Zabbixissa on 2 osaa: 1) Zabbix Server ja 2) Zabbix Agent.
Jos haluat valvoa tietokonettasi/palvelintasi Zabbixilla, Zabbix Agent on oltava asennettuna tietokoneellesi/palvelimellesi. Se kommunikoi ja lähettää tarvittavat tiedot Zabbix -palvelimelle (joka toimii Raspberry Pi -laitteellasi).
Zabbix Agentin asentaminen Ubuntu/Debian/Raspberry Pi -käyttöjärjestelmään
Zabbix Agent on saatavana Ubuntun/Debianin/Raspberry Pi OS: n virallisesta pakettivarastosta. Joten se on helppo asentaa.
Päivitä ensin APT -paketin arkiston välimuisti seuraavalla komennolla:
$sudoosuva päivitys
Voit asentaa Zabbix Agentin seuraavalla komennolla:
Zabbix Agent tulee asentaa.
Avaa Zabbix Agent -määritystiedosto /etc/zabbix/zabbix_agentd.conf seuraavalla komennolla:
$sudo nano /jne/zabbix/zabbix_agentd.conf
Muuta Palvelin muuttuja Zabbix -palvelimesi IP -osoitteeseen (Raspberry Pi -laitteen IP -osoitteeseen).
Varmista myös, että Isäntänimi muuttuja on asetettu tietokoneen/palvelimen isäntänimeksi. Jos et tiedä ,. isäntänimi tietokoneesta/palvelimesta, voit suorittaa isäntänimen komennon ja selvittää sen.
Kun olet valmis, paina + X jonka jälkeen JA ja< Tulla sisään > pelastaakseen /etc/zabbix/zabbix_agentd.conf -tiedosto .
Jotta muutokset tulevat voimaan, käynnistä zabbix-agentti palvelu seuraavalla komennolla:
The zabbix-agentti pitäisi olla käynnissä, kuten näet alla olevasta kuvakaappauksesta.
Zabbix Agentin asentaminen CentOS/RHEL -laitteeseen 8
Jos haluat asentaa Zabbix Agentin CentOS/RHEL 8 -järjestelmään, sinun on lisättävä Zabbix -pakettivarasto CentOS/RHEL 8 -tietokoneeseen/-palvelimeen.
Jos haluat lisätä Zabbix -paketin arkiston CentOS/RHEL 8 -laitteeseen, suorita seuraava komento:
$sudorpm-huhhttps://repo.zabbix.com/zabbix/5.2/rhel/8/x86_64/zabbix-julkaisu5.2-1.el8.noarch.rpm
Zabbix Package -varasto tulisi lisätä.
Päivitä DNF -paketin arkiston välimuisti seuraavalla komennolla:
Asentaa Zabbix -agentti , suorita seuraava komento:
Vahvista asennus painamalla JA ja paina sitten< Tulla sisään >.
Hyväksy GPG -näppäin painamalla JA ja paina sitten< Tulla sisään >.
Zabbix Agent tulee asentaa.
Avaa Zabbix Agent -määritystiedosto /etc/zabbix/zabbix_agentd.conf seuraavalla komennolla:
$sudo nano /jne/zabbix/zabbix_agentd.conf
Muuta Palvelin muuttuja Zabbix -palvelimesi IP -osoitteeseen (Raspberry Pi -laitteen IP -osoitteeseen).
Varmista myös, että Isäntänimi muuttuja on asetettu tietokoneen/palvelimen isäntänimeksi. Jos et tiedä ,. isäntänimi tietokoneesta/palvelimesta, voit suorittaa isäntänimen komennon ja selvittää sen.
Kun olet valmis, paina< Ctrl > + X jonka jälkeen JA ja< Tulla sisään > pelastaakseen /etc/zabbix/zabbix_agentd.conf -tiedosto.
Käynnistä zabbix-agentti systemd -palvelu seuraavalla komennolla:
The zabbix-agentti palvelun pitäisi olla käynnissä, kuten näet alla olevasta kuvakaappauksesta.
Lisää zabbix-agentti palvelu järjestelmän käynnistykseen, jotta se käynnistyy automaattisesti järjestelmän käynnistyksen yhteydessä:
Suorita seuraava komento määrittääksesi palomuurin sallimaan pääsyn Zabbix Agent -porttiin 10050:
Suorita seuraava komento, jotta palomuurimuutokset tulevat voimaan:
Zabbix Agentin asentaminen Windows 10: een
Windows 10: ssä sinun on ladattava Zabbix Agent -ohjelmisto Zabbixin viralliselta verkkosivustolta.
Käy ensin Zabbix Agentin virallinen lataussivu verkkoselaimesta.
Kun sivu on latautunut, valitse Windows MSI -paketti alla olevan kuvakaappauksen mukaisesti.
Vieritä sitten hieman alas ja napsauta ensimmäistä LADATA linkki alla olevan kuvakaappauksen mukaisesti.
Zabbix Agentin asennusohjelma on ladattava. Suorita asennusohjelma.
Klikkaa Seuraava .
Tarkista Hyväksyn käyttöoikeussopimuksen valintaruudun ehdot ja napsauta Seuraava .
Varmista, että isäntänimi on oikea. Kirjoita Zabbix -palvelimen IP -osoite ja tarkista Lisää agentin sijainti PATH -valintaruutuun .
Kun olet valmis, napsauta Seuraava .
Klikkaa Seuraava .
Klikkaa Asentaa .
Klikkaa Joo.
Zabbix -agentti pitäisi asentaa. Klikkaa Viedä loppuun .
Linux -isännän lisääminen Zabbixiin
Kun Zabbix Agent on asennettu tietokoneellesi/palvelimellesi, voit lisätä sen Zabbix -palvelimeen (joka toimii Raspberry Pi -laitteellasi).
Kirjaudu ensin Zabbix -verkkosovellukseen ja siirry osoitteeseen Kokoonpano> Isännät . Napsauta sitten Luo isäntä , kuten alla olevassa kuvakaappauksessa on merkitty.
Kirjoita sen tietokoneen/palvelimen isäntänimi, johon yrität lisätä Isännän nimi ala. Napsauta sitten Valitse , kuten alla olevassa kuvakaappauksessa on merkitty.
Tarkista Linux -palvelimet valintaruutu ja napsauta Valitse .
Klikkaa Lisätä , kuten alla olevassa kuvakaappauksessa on merkitty.
Klikkaa Agentti .
Kirjoita sen tietokoneen/palvelimen IP -osoite, jonka yrität lisätä Zabbixiin.
Kun olet valmis, napsauta Lisätä .
Linux -isäntä tulisi lisätä Zabbixiin, kuten näet alla olevasta kuvakaappauksesta.
Windows 10 -isäntän lisääminen Zabbixiin
Tässä osassa näytän sinulle, kuinka voit lisätä Windows 10 -isäntä Zabbixiin. Aloitetaan siis.
Luodaksemme uuden isäntäryhmän Windows -isännille vain pitääksesi asiat järjestyksessä.
Voit luoda isäntäryhmän siirtymällä osoitteeseen Kokoonpano> Isäntä ryhmiä Zabbix -verkkosovelluksesta. Napsauta sitten Luo isäntäryhmä .
Kirjoita Windows -isännät, ja napsauta Lisätä .
Uusi isäntäryhmä, Windows -isännät , pitäisi lisätä.
Jos haluat lisätä Windows 10 -isäntäsi Zabbixiin, siirry kohtaan C kokoonpano> Isännät . Napsauta sitten Luo isäntä .
Kirjoita Windows 10 -isäntäsi isäntänimi tai tietokoneen nimi kohtaan Isännän nimi ala. Napsauta sitten Valitse , kuten alla olevassa kuvakaappauksessa on merkitty.
Tarkista äskettäin luotu ryhmä Windows -isännät ja napsauta Valitse .
Klikkaa Lisätä , kuten alla olevassa kuvakaappauksessa on merkitty.
Klikkaa Agentti .
Kirjoita Windows 10 -isäntäsi IP -osoite ja napsauta Lisätä .
Windows 10 -isäntäsi on lisättävä Zabbixiin.
Linux -isäntien verkon käytön seuranta
Tässä osassa näytän sinulle, kuinka voit seurata Linux -isäntien verkkokäyttöä Zabbix 5: n avulla. Joten aloitetaan.
Siirry ensin kohteeseen Kokoonpano> Isännät ja napsauta Linux -isäntää, jonka haluat seurata verkon käyttöä.
Klikkaa Mallit .
Klikkaa Valitse , kuten alla olevassa kuvakaappauksessa on merkitty.
Klikkaa Valitse , kuten alla olevassa kuvakaappauksessa on merkitty.
Klikkaa Mallit , kuten alla olevassa kuvakaappauksessa on merkitty.
Tarkistaa Zabbix -agentin Linux -verkkoliitännät valintaruutu ja napsauta Valitse.
Klikkaa Päivittää .
Linux -isäntä on päivitettävä.
Jonkin ajan kuluttua ZBX -saatavuus tulee korostaa, kuten näet alla olevasta kuvakaappauksesta.
Kun ZBX -vaihtoehto on korostettu, siirry kohtaan Valvonta> Isännät ja napsauta Kojelaudat linkki Linux -isäntäsi, kuten näet alla olevasta kuvakaappauksesta.
Kuten näette, verkon käyttökaavio näytetään.
Voit myös muuttaa kaavion aikajanaa. Kuten näette, olen muuttanut kaavion ajan arvoksi Viimeiset 15 minuuttia . Kaavio näkyy hienosti.
Näin voit seurata Linux -isännän verkkokäyttöä Zabbixin avulla Raspberry Pi -laitteellasi.
Windows -isäntien verkon käytön seuranta
Tässä osassa näytän sinulle, kuinka voit seurata Windows 10 -isäntien verkkokäyttöä Zabbix 5: n avulla. Joten aloitetaan.
Siirry ensin kohteeseen Kokoonpano> Isännät ja napsauta Windows 10 -isäntää, jonka haluat seurata verkon käyttöä.
Klikkaa Mallit .
Klikkaa Valitse , kuten alla olevassa kuvakaappauksessa on merkitty.
Klikkaa Valitse , kuten alla olevassa kuvakaappauksessa on merkitty.
Klikkaa Mallit , kuten alla olevassa kuvakaappauksessa on merkitty.
Tarkistaa Windows -verkko Zabbix -agentin toimesta ja napsauta Valitse .
Klikkaa Päivittää .
The Windows 10 isäntä on päivitettävä.
Jonkin ajan kuluttua ZBX -saatavuus tulee korostaa, kuten näet alla olevasta kuvakaappauksesta.
Kun ZBX -vaihtoehto on korostettu, siirry kohtaan Valvonta> Isännät ja napsauta Kojelaudat linkki Windows 10 -isäntäsi, kuten näet alla olevasta kuvakaappauksesta.
Kuten näette, verkon käyttökaavio näytetään.
Voit myös muuttaa kaavion aikajanaa. Kuten näette, olen muuttanut kaavion ajan arvoksi Viimeiset 15 minuuttia . Kaavio näkyy hienosti.
Näin voit seurata Windows 10 -isännän verkkokäyttöä Zabbixin avulla Raspberry Pi -laitteellasi.
Johtopäätös
Tässä artikkelissa olen näyttänyt sinulle, miten voit luoda Raspberry Pi -verkkomonitorin Zabbix 5: llä.